📝 Our Take

The Manual Road Crossing set is a charming snapshot of classic LEGO town life. Released in 1985 under the 4.5V theme, this set captures a simpler time with its focus on railway infrastructure and a pedestrian crossing, perfect for integrating into any vintage LEGO city layout.

This set is perfect for LEGO enthusiasts interested in vintage trains and town layouts. With a manageable piece count, it offers a straightforward and enjoyable build, evoking a sense of nostalgia and making it an excellent addition to a retro-themed collection.

Skip this if you're primarily interested in modern, highly detailed sets with complex building techniques. Consider exploring newer City sets with more advanced features and larger builds if you prefer contemporary LEGO designs.

Compare Similar Sets

Compared to modern LEGO City train sets, the Manual Road Crossing offers a simpler, more nostalgic building experience. While lacking the advanced features and complexity of newer sets, its vintage charm and compatibility with classic LEGO train layouts make it a unique addition. Collectors interested in expanding their train layouts may also consider sets like the 60197 Passenger Train for modern functionality or 7745 High-Speed City Express Train for another vintage option, but the 7835 offers a unique crossing element not found in those sets.

1 Minifigures Included

The set includes a classic Town minifigure featuring a blue jacket, blue legs, and a red hat, representative of the standard LEGO citizen during the 1980s.
